Specifications
Size / Dimension: 0.630" Dia (16.00mm)
Height - Seated (Max): 0.866" (22.00mm)
Surface Mount Land Size: --
Mounting Type: Through Hole
Package / Case: Radial, Can
Series: TA
Packaging: Bulk 
Lead Free Status / RoHS Status: --
Part Status: Active
Moisture Sensitivity Level (MSL): --
Capacitance: 220µF
Tolerance: ±20%
Voltage - Rated: 63V
ESR (Equivalent Series Resistance): --
Lifetime @ Temp.: 2000 Hrs @ 125°C
Operating Temperature: -40°C ~ 125°C
Polarization: Polar
Ratings: --
Applications: General Purpose
Ripple Current @ Low Frequency: 884mA @ 120Hz
Ripple Current @ High Frequency: 1.36A @ 100kHz
Impedance: 85 mOhms
Lead Spacing: 0.295" (7.50mm)
